A legal action might be appropriate if filing a problem with the EEOC or a state company does not settle the problem or if the work environment harassment is severe and ongoing. For the most part, you have to first submit an EEOC fee before suing, but once you receive a "right-to-sue" letter, you can take your case to court. How Much Can A Person Sue For Sexual Abuse In The Work Environment?
Instances of unwanted sexual advances include different forms of verbal, physical, and non-verbal conduct. Spoken conduct might consist of inappropriate jokes, remarks, or repeated unwanted sex-related advancements. Physical conduct can involve unwanted touching, searching, or blocking a person's movement. Non-verbal actions may consist of leering, presenting offending pictures, or sending symptomatic messages. Also if the harassment does not entail physical call, relentless unwanted actions can still certify. Recording everything relating to office unwanted sexual advances is crucial. Whether to resolve or proceed to test is an important decision in any employment situation. Many employers choose to deal with the matter early to prevent the danger of public analysis and the unpredictability of a court decision. Employees, on the various other hand, might accept a negotiation to get faster compensation and prevent the stress of a test.
